20th
November 2009:
The possible hybrid Glaucous-winged Gull still present on Lissadell Strand, in a flock of c. 1,000 gulls, mostly Herring Gulls, but with an increasing component of Great Black-backed Gulls in the flock. |

14th November 2009: This gull, showing features of Glaucous-winged Gull, was found at Lissadell by Derek Charles and Séamus Feeney this afternoon.
